Output 8d76666273908a7ad4fd035222ead8427fa553c2fdf8354ae147fca4f13dcbdb:1

value
34446629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5151752e8d78c4d3144d4e9f2c95d5f3cc526f5b OP_EQUAL
address
MFK8YkYW443EKwuVLiKR2ZCHCLXkVztogW
transaction
8d76666273908a7ad4fd035222ead8427fa553c2fdf8354ae147fca4f13dcbdb
spent
true